1. Approval of Minutes
28 February Meeting
(IAC-M-232)
Approved as written,
Watch Committee Report
No,. 291
a. The report was noted,
b, Mr., Dulles said that he planned to bring the seriousness
of developments in the Arab-Isareli situation to the attention of the
President.. Before doing so` he would take note of findings of the
Watch Committee at its 7 March meeting.

4. . NIE 11-56
Soviet Gross Capabilities for
Attack on US and Key Overseas
Installations and Forces
Through Mid-1959
a. Approved as amended.
b. Mr. Kent was directed to include at the appropriate
place in the estimate a footnote defining Soviet aircraft types
referred to throughout the estimate,
c. Agreed to defer consideration of the post-mortem on
this estimate and the validity study of NIE 11-7-55.
Adjournment: 1315
